Abstract
Advances in artificial intelligence and machine learning - in particular neural networks - have given rise to a new generation of virtual assistants and chatbots. Within this work, we describe the motivation and architecture of NADiA - Neurally Animated Dialog Agent - which leverages both the user's verbal input and facial expressions for multi-modal conversation. NADiA combines a neural language model that generates conversational responses, a convolutional neural network for facial expression analysis, and virtual human technology that is deployed on a mobile phone.
